How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Dickeyville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Dickeyville Studio Apartments | $1,286 | $1,040 | $1,449 |
| Dickeyville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,244 | $650 | $1,550 |
| Dickeyville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,409 | $775 | $1,810 |
| Dickeyville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,744 | $895 | $2,299 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Dickeyville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Studio Dickeyville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Dickeyville is $1,286.
What is the largest available Studio Dickeyville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Dickeyville is a 622 square feet unit starting from $1,369 at Windsor Forest.
What is the average size for Dickeyville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Dickeyville is currently 553 sq ft.
